BEG'GAR, n. See Beg. One that lives by asking alms, or makes it his business to beg for charity.

1. One who supplicates with humility a petitioner but in this sense rarely used, as the word has become a term of contempt.
2. One who assumes in argument what he does not prove.

BEG'GAR, To reduce to beggary to impoverish.

1. To deprive or make destitute to exhaust as, to beggar description.
